When sunlight hits a raindrop, the red light waves are bent at an angle of 42 degrees from their original direction from the sun. ... The other colored light frequencies are bent at angles in between these two. This is why we see rainbows as a continuous band of colors with red on top and violet on the bottom.Apr 10, 2006
